Quinton de Kock

"Ten years into international cricket, Quinton de Kock is the most experienced cricketer for South Africa at the ODI World Cup. Quinton de Kock's fearless batting and exceptional glovework earned him comparisons to game greats like Adam Gilchrist. By the time he turned 21, he had shared the record for the most successive ODI centuries – three – against India. De Kock is going to be an indispensable cog for his country if the perennial underachiever punches above their weight. It is not because he is one of the senior most in the team hut he has a proven record in India playing for different franchises in the IPL The southpaw, who now plays for Lucknow Super Giants, has played a pivotal role in Mumbai Indians winning the back-to-back IPL titles in 2019 and 2020. De Kock has had a fair share of controversy, be it refusing to take a knee in the T20 World Cup or announcing a shock retirement from Tests in 2021 to concentrate on the white-ball formats and playing in the T20 leagues across the globe.

One-day memory: (Three ODI centuries against India in 2013)

Quinton de Kock has 17 centuries in ODIs, and six out of those have come against India. He hit three in a single series in 2013 and ended that series with 342 runs at an average of 114.

One more thing: Quinton de Kock likes a good catch. Not only behind the stumps, snaffling flying leather projectiles effortlessly, but also beside quaint lakes, with a graphite fishing rod in hand. He considers himself a better fisherman than his former teammate Dale Steyn as he has claimed he caught an 180-pound Tarpon and 200-kilo sharks. The Southpaw is also reportedly the best dancer in the South African dressing room."
